Need to disable fix version field for role jira-users only in few projects. Is it possible?
you can try with this using javascript something like this, here i am showing fixversion field to jira users group, you need to modify as per your requirement
<script type="text/javascript"> JIRA.bind(JIRA.Events.NEW_CONTENT_ADDED, function (e,context) { hideTab(); }) function hideTab(){ var user=getCurrentUserName(); if(isUserInGroup(user,'jira-users') ){ //to hide fixversion field $("#fixVersions-multi-select").closest('div.field-group').hide(); }else { $("#fixVersions-multi-select").closest('div.field-group').show(); } } function getCurrentUserName() { var user; AJS.$.ajax({ url: "/rest/gadget/1.0/currentUser", type: 'get', dataType: 'json', async: false, success: function(data) { user = data.username; } }); return user; } function getGroups(user) { var groups; AJS.$.ajax({ url: "/rest/api/2/user?username="+user+"&expand=groups", type: 'get', dataType: 'json', async: false, success: function(data) { groups = data.groups.items; } }); return groups; } function isUserInGroup(user, group){ var groups = getGroups(user); for (i = 0; i < groups.length; i++){ if (groups[i].name == group){ return true; } } return false; } </script>
Yes, you can limit the "Resolve Issue" project permission to prevent people from setting the fix version field.
https://confluence.atlassian.com/display/JIRA/Managing+Project+Permissions
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
This is for Resolve Issue permission but how can this restrict users from changing the fix version field?
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.